The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est troubles come under three buckets. Architectural bugs,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the building itself. Sanitation pests, such as cockroaches, flies, and rats, grow on food resources and dampness.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or vermins, exploit openings and conditions however do not always nest in your house. Each category demands a various method, and a great pest control company will customize the plan accordingly.

When I strolled a 1920s bungalow with a new homeowner who kept hearing faint rustling during the night, the very first technician she called proposed a perennial general solution, month-to-month check outs, and a rodent lure station package for the exterior. He never climbed into the attic room. A competitor spent f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ch void at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all. The second specialist sealed the entrance factor, set traps in particular path locations, eliminated the carcasses, and complied with up twice. This job expense less than 2 months of the initial plan and ended the problem within a week. Good pest control starts with examination, not with a sales script.

What a credible inspection looks like

If the first browse through lasts 5 mins and finishes with a laminated cost sheet, maintain looking. An appropriate examination has a rhythm. Outdoors, a professional circles the structure, downspouts, and plants clearance, checking for conducive problems such as wood-to-soil call, wet compost versus exterior siding, and voids at energy penetrations. Indoors, they follow moisture and heat. Kitchens, washrooms, laundry room, cellar sills, and attic room air flow all obtain a look. They might ask to relocate the oven cabinet or look under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they check for rub marks, droppings, and gnaw points at door corners. For termites, they search for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in baseboards. For bed pests, they peel back joints and inspect tufts.

A seasoned exterminator tells as they go, even if briefly. You will certainly hear remarks like, "These droppings follow comput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They might make use of a dampness meter on suspicious timber or a flashlight at ground level to detect ants trailing during the heat of the day. The tools do not require to be expensive. Curiosity matters more than equipment.

Credentials that in fact matter

Licensing and insurance coverage are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the correct state licenses for structural pest control and, when needed, a different certificate for bed insect or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of basic liability and workers' payment insurance coverage. I have actually seen attic joists broken by a careless action,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der damages in seamless gutters. Insurance exists because mishaps happen.

Beyond licensing, search for proof of continuing education and learning. In several states, specialists require a number of CEUs each year to preserve their credential. When a business invests in training, you see it in the area choices. During a heat wave one summertime, I enjoyed a tech sw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el because the colony had actually moved to healthy protein. That choice comes from practice and training.

Experience by insect type matters greater than years in organization. A newer pest control contractor that treats bed insects weekly commonly outperforms a large exterminator company that sends a generalist two times a year. Ask, "The number of bed pest work have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the common causes when they fall short?" Pay attention for particular numbers or ranges and frank explanations.

The strategy should match the insect, the framework, and your tolerance

A reputable exterminator service will certainly recommend an integrated strategy. You might hear the acronym IPM, incorporated insect administration. Water, food, and harborage decrease precede. Chemical controls, when utilized, are precise and targeted.

For rodents, a good str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or hardware fabric. Catches inside, bait stations outside where permitted, and sanitation procedures like sealed pet food work together. If a proposal leans on toxin inside living spaces without a plan to remove carcasses or seal access factors,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For cockroaches, hygiene and gain access to issue as much as chemical choice. I when collaborated with a dining establishment that cut German roach coun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ks just by shutting floor drain gaps with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down procedures.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ulators and lures, applied as pin-sized droplets, not program sprays. The combination stuck because the atmosphere changed.

For termites, the choice usually boils down to soil treatments versus lures. A liquid termiticide creates a treated zone that termites can not go across. It supplies prompt defense yet requires boring and trenching. Bait systems, such as those set up around the perimeter, can eliminate nests gradually and are much less invasive, however they need surveillance and persistence. A great exterminator lays out both courses with pros, disadvantages, and costs, then points to problems on your property that idea the choice. Heavy clay soil, high water tables, slab building and construction, or historical block can all affect the therapy choice.

For bed pests, warm, chemical, or incorporated approaches all work when executed well. Whole-home heat therapies get to deadly temperature levels for a sustained time. They require preparation, remove chemical deposits, and can be costly. Chemical treatments with cautious split and crevice applications and dusting in gaps cost much less however need multiple brows through. A firm that uses both, or that partners with a specialist, is normally extra flexible and sincere about compromises.

Price, value, and the cost of inexpensive promises

Pricing varies by area and problem. For a common single-family home, basic pest control may run 300 to 600 bucks per year for quarterly service. Bed pest work commonly range from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ending on spaces and method.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for install, plus annual monitoring fees, while soil treatments for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exclusion can vary hugely, from a few hundred for sealing small spaces to a number of thousand for hefty architectural work.

The cheapest proposal can be a trap. Here are the concerns I ask when two proposals are much apart:

  • What specifically is included in the initial service and the follow-ups? How many check outs and on what schedule?
  • Which items or techniques will you make use of, at what areas, and why those over alternatives?
  • What conditions do you need me to address, and exactly how will certainly we confirm that each side did their part?
  • What does your assurance promise and leave out, and how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will be my recurring specialist, and exactly how do I reach them in between visits?

If the reduced proposal consists of fewer sees, less surveillance, or no extent for exemption,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a higher proposal covers repairs, securing, and sanitation devices that stop reoccuring prices. On one multifamily home, a business proposed glue catches and monthly spray downs for mice. One more proposal was 40 percent greater and included securing 35 penetrations, mounting door moves, and eliminating the dumpster overflow. The 2nd strategy minimized call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the complete year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most issues I have seen after the truth were foreseeable from the initial get in touch with. Firms that promise a long-term fix to an open atmosphere problem, like m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are selling hope, not a service. Assurances that include many exemptions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from bordering units," are not necessarily poor, but they require to be described, not concealed behind fine print. If a sales associate stands up to listing details, avoid them. If a specialist is reluctant to show you item tags or security information sheets upon request, keep your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that assert to cover whatever without inspection charges or add-ons. When you review the contract, you may find that bed pests, termites, wildlife, and German roaches are left out. That kind of strategy fits, particularly for seasonal ants or occasional crawlers, yet it will not aid with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unnecessary wide applications. If you see a technician fogging the baseboards in every room for ants, they are treating the signs and symptom, not the cause. The colony is outdoors. That chemical does little greater than leave deposit where your kids and pet dogs live. You want targeted baits, crack and crevice applications behind button plates, or perimeter perimeter therapies that resolve the route, not inside fogging for show.

Contracts and assurances that suggest something

A good assurance has clear triggers and treatments. It needs to mention the covered parasites, the length of time co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what activities void the guarantee. For termites, you will see repair service guarantees, retreat-only warranties, or hybrid versions. Repair assurances can be useful if you rely on the company's durability and their procedure, yet they are often more expensive. Retreat-only can be completely great if you check yearly and preserve a document of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you plan to market within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some general pest control contracts auto-renew with tight cancellation charges. If you see early termination penalties that surpass the rest of the service value, bargain or walk.

Payment terms tell you about a company's self-confidence. Sensible deposits for major work are regular. Complete early repayment for unrendered services is not, unless a discount compensates and you rely on the provider. For bed bugs, suppliers sometimes stage repayments throughout gos to, which aligns incentives.

Safety and ecological considerations without the slogans

Homeowners commonly ask for "eco-friendly" services. The term is unclear. What matters is ex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control minimizes the demand for chemicals with exemption and hygiene, then utilizes the least-toxic reliable product in the smallest amount, in one of the most targeted area, for the shortest time. That could be a desiccant dirt in a wall space, a gel bait under a countertop lip, or a growth regulator in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it might be larvicide in standing water and a corrected quality for runoff.

Ask the service technician to walk you with the products they intend to use. Read the energetic ingredients on the tag, not simply the brand name. If you have family pets, aquariums, or youngsters with asthma, say so early. Excellent business note those details in your data and adjust formulations and application techniques. I have actually seen specialists swap out pyrethroids near aquarium or avoid aerosol providers near oxygen tools. These are tiny changes that make a large difference.

Ventilation after treatment is typically uncomplicated. Easy open-window durations, often 30 to 60 mins, are enough for numerous interior applications. For warmth treatments, they will establish the time and monitoring devices.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are rare for single-family homes outside of certain termite or whole-structure circumstances, the security protocols are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your provider seems informal reg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ing quotes: a sensible way to line them up

Paperwork from pest control companies is notoriously hard to contrast. One checklists every chemical with percent toughness, one more presents a friendly summary regarding "multi-point protection," and the third offers a solitary number and a signature line. Develop a basic grid on your own. Write parasite type, treatment approach, number of visits, included fixings or sealing, checking schedule, warranty terms, overall price,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and load in any type of bl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to exactly how they manage your inquiries. Do they get defensive or insightful? Do they send out modified extents in composing? I collaborated with a building supervisor that chose suppliers based upon their responsiveness throughout this phase, not just reward or referrals. The logic was audio. If they communicate plainly when trying to gain your business, they will most likely do so during service.

When wildlife creeps into the picture

Not every pest control service handles wildlife.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the chimney call for a different license in many states and a various ability. Wildlife control concentrates on humane trapping, one-way doors, and repair work of access points, typically complied with by sanitizing infected insulation. If you think wild animals, ask directly whether the exterminator company has that ability or partners with a wild animals professional. A basic pest control technician who establishes a couple of residential pest control traps without sealing access factors will certainly produce a cycle of return gos to without resolution.

What preparedness resembles on your side

Clients influence results. A clean, obtainable, and well-prepared home enables service technicians to bring their finest job. For cockroaches, bag and eliminate the cupboard items the night prior to so they can access gaps and joints. For bed bugs, comply with the prep list exactly, but beware of over-prepping. Getting every thing and moving little furniture across spaces can distribute insects. A good business will give certain, determined instructions such as laundering bedding above warmth,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in place for correct treatment.

In rentals, coordinating accessibility and holding both occupant and proprietor liable issues as much as therapy option. In one building with recurring cockroach concerns, the supervisor wrote prep guidelines in three languages, included picture-based overviews on just how to clear cupboards, and sent a personnel the day before to assist elderly locals raise light things. Treatment effectiveness enhanced by fifty percent without changing chemicals.

The role of technology without the buzzwords

Remote screens, smart traps, and digital reporting have actually made pest control easier to validate. I do not hire a specialist for devices, however I value companies that record what they did, where, and when. A simple image of a secured gap, a map of lure stations with solution dates, or a log of trap checks tells me the plan was performed. Some service providers supply customer websites with service reports and product labels. That transparency aids when personnel modification or when you market the property.

Seasonality, local peculiarities,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and subterranean termites use constant st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of rats develop different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in fall as temperatures decrease. High elevation communities see collection flies congregate on south-facing wall surfaces in late summertime. Your option of pest control company should mirror neighborhood experience. Ask what seasonal pests they anticipate and how they change schedules. A quarterly routine could shift to bi-monthly throughout peak months and twice a year in winter season, or the contrary for sure pests.

For historic hom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framing make complex exemption. You might need a specialist who recognizes how to secure without asphyxiating, exactly how to maintain ventilation while blocking access, and exactly how to deal with timber participants sensitively. For green roof coverings or pollinator yards, you want a team that can secure beneficial bugs while attending to bugs that intimidate individuals and structures.

References and credibility that go deeper than star ratings

Online examines aid, but they squash subtlety. Look for patterns over years, not simply a high score last month. A business with thousands of reviews across 5 or even more years and detailed remarks about details parasites is a safer wager than a handful of glowing notes that seem like marketing. Request for two referrals for the pest you are managing. When you call, ask what went wrong initially, then ask exactly how the firm reacted. Straightforward business make errors, and the method they recuperate informs you greater than perfection claims.

Local residential property supervisors, restaurant proprietors, and home assessors can be candid sources. They see specialists working when there is no sales pitch. If several pros state the same name with regard, pay attention.

When nationwide chains versus regional operators is not the actual question

Large exterminator firms bring standardization, deeper bench strength, and usually quicker emergency situation feedback. Local pest control professionals bring versatility, connections, and sometimes sharper prices. I have actually hired both. The far better inquiry is healthy. Does the particular branch or proprietor have the service technician quality, parasite experience, and solution culture your circumstance demands? Several of the best termite therapies I have actually seen were from little companies that treat thousands of homes per year in one county. Some of the very best multi-site rodent programs came from national carriers with data-driven scheduling and specialized account managers. Prevent stereotypes and evaluate the team that will actually serve you.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.

How often should pest control come in Florida?

In Florida, many households use quarterly service for general prevention because pests are active year-round in warm, humid conditions. Some situations justify monthly visits, such as heavy pressure, recurring activity, or specific pest issues. Termite risk is often managed with periodic inspections and ongoing monitoring systems rather than only “spray” visits. The right frequency depends on pest history, construction type, and surrounding environment.
